Declension of German noun Minarett with plural and article

The most important forms of "Minarett" are: genitive singular "Minaretts" and nominative plural "Minarette/Minaretts". “Minarett” is declined with the strong declension. The endings are s/e/s. "Minarett" is neuter. The article is "das Minarett". “Minarett” belongs to the vocabulary at C2 level. Here you can not only inflect Minarett but also all German nouns. Comments

Declension of Minarett in singular and plural in all cases

Singular

Nom. dasMinarett
Gen. desMinaretts
Dat. demMinarett
Acc. dasMinarett

Plural

Nom. dieMinarette/Minaretts
Gen. derMinarette/Minaretts
Dat. denMinaretten/Minaretts
Acc. dieMinarette/Minaretts

Examples

Example sentences for Minarett


  • Minarette sind die Türme von Moscheen. 
    English Minarets are the towers of mosques.
  • Vom Minarett erklang der Ruf des Muezzins. 
    English From the minaret, the call of the muezzin sounded.
  • Der Turm von Sevillas Kathedrale war einst ein Minarett . 
    English The steeple of the cathedral of Seville used to be a minaret.
  • Vom Minarett der Moschee rief der Muezzin die Gläubigen zum Gebet. 
    English From the minaret of the mosque, the muezzin called the believers to prayer.
  • Die Schweiz hat sich dem Bau von Minaretten auf ihrem Gebiet widersetzt. 
    English Switzerland has opposed the construction of minarets on its territory.
  • Vom nahen Minarett ertönt der Gesang des bärtigen Moslems, der dort Allah ehrt, und die zarten Wölkchen der Zigaretten kräuseln sich um die entschleierten Angesichter schwarzäugiger Türkinnen. 
    English From the nearby minaret, the singing of the bearded Muslim can be heard, who honors Allah there, and the delicate clouds of cigarette smoke curl around the unveiled faces of black-eyed Turkish women.
